Charlie Sheen to Follow in Kiefer Sutherland’s Footsteps and Spend His Series Vacation in Jail

Some television actors spend their off-season auditioning for film roles, vacationing with their families, or recording horrible, self-indulgent singles . Others use their downtime to fulfill that court-mandated jail sentence, like Kiefer Sutherland, who spent 48 days in lock down in 2007 after pleading no contest to DUI charges. Now it seems that Charlie Sheen will follow in the footsteps of the 24 star by forgoing trial and agreeing to spend up to 30 days in jail during his summer vacation.

Charlie Sheen to Cop Plea, Go to Jail

According to multiple sources, there’s no longer any question over whether or not Charlie Sheen will spend time in jail for his Christmas Day assault against wife Brooke Mueller. The troubled actor is most definitely headed to the slammer. Sheen is prepared to agree to a plea bargain that will include approximately 30 days behind bars. “Charlie intends to go to court on June 7 [to] plead to a misdemeanor and immediately begin serving his 30 days in jail,” said an insider. “With good behavior, he could end up doing 15 or so days.” Let’s all hope Charlie Sheen gets up close and personal with fellow inmates in a very different way this month. Incredibly, Sheen had the option of avoiding prison and accepting probation – but he actually deemed probation too risky, which is basically a case of the star admitting that he can’t remain out of trouble. The actor will go to Aspen next Monday, enter a no-contest plea to third degree assault and have his felony menacing charge dropped. In the end, for allegedly holding a knife to the throat of Mueller, Sheen will receive a pay raise from CBS and spend about two weeks in jail. Ain’t justice grand for celebrities?
